Hollandaise Sauce. You can buy a packet (from McCormacks) and I think you just add butter or water(it's been years) or something. I remember it being really good. I used to use it over asparagus. I don't know how from scratch.
 
It is very tough to make from scratch and the McCormick packet is really just as good and much more stable. I would go for the packet. If you have a friend who is a very good cook who can show you how to make hollandaise from scratch, have them show you sometime. Just make sure you add a teenie bit of lemon to the McCormick and it will be yummier.

I worked at restaurant and we used it for banquets because it was so stable. Homemade will "break" or separate and then it is just a bowl of yuck.
